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
Mitel InAttend versions prior to 2.5 SP3
Mitel CMG versions prior to 8.4 SP3
Description
The issue is related to a default password in the BluStar component, which could allow remote attackers to gain unauthorized access and execute arbitrary scripts. This could potentially impact the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the system.
Recommendations
For Mitel InAttend versions prior to 2.5 SP3, update to version 2.5 SP3 or later to resolve the issue.
For Mitel CMG versions prior to 8.4 SP3, update to version 8.4 SP3 or later to resolve the issue.
